Zeiss LSM 800
High quantum efficiency GaAsP detector

Description
The Zeiss LSM 800 is an inverted Zeiss Axio Observer Z1 laser scanning confocal microscope equipped with high quantum efficiency GaAsP detector, 2 multi-alkali PMTs and DIC optics for trans-illumination microscopy with each objective.
Specifications
- Airyscan2
- GaAsP detector
- 2x multi alkali PMT’s
- T-PMT (transmitted light detector)
- DIC optics
- CO2 and temp control stage insert
- Motorised stage
-
- 10x, NA 0.45, Plan-Apochromat, Air, 2mm WD
- 20x, NA 0.8, Plan-Apochromat, Air, 0.55mm WD
- 40x, NA 1.3, Plan-Apochromat, Oil, 0.21mm WD
- 63x, NA 1.4, Plan-Apochromat, Oil, 0.19mm WD
